Power Supply
AGILENT-Hp/Keysight 6644A
Output Ratings
Output voltage: 0 to 60 V
Output current (40° C): 0 to 3.5 A
Maximum current (50° C/55° C): 3.2 A/3 AProgramming Accuracy at 25°C ±5°C
Voltage 0.06% + 26 mV
Current 0.15% + 4.1 mARipple & Noise (20 Hz – 20 MHz)
Voltage rms: 500 µV
Voltage peak-to-peak: 5 mV
Current rms: 1.5 mAKeysight high performance DC power supplies offer speed and accuracy for test optimization. The single output, 200 W, GPIB 6641A-6645A provide fast, low-noise outputs; analog control of output voltage and current; fan-speed control to minimize acoustic noise; as well as parallel and series connections of multiple units.
The Keysight 210W, GPIB, single output 6644A is a versatile programmable supply designed to maximize test throughput during design verification or on the production line, and is fully programmable to help reduce test time through a variety of automated capabilities.

NOISE SOURCE
HP-AGILENT/KEYSIGHT 346C
HP 346C Noise Source, 10 MHz to 26.5 GHz, nominal ENR 15 dB
The HP 346C noise source is the ideal companion to Keysight's noise figure solutions. Since it is broadband (10 MHz to 26.5 GHz), it eliminates the necessity for several sources at different frequency bands. The low SWR of the noise source reduces a major source of measurement uncertainty; reflections of test signals. Option K01 is a coaxial noise source and features coverage from 1 to 50 GHz with a 2.4 mm coaxial connector.
• Frequency range: 10 MHz to 26.5 GHz
